Job description
We are seeking an experienced IT Security Consultant/Linux Systems Administrator to join our team on site in Williston, VT. This role involves maintaining, securing, and enhancing enterprise Linux systems in a multi-site, High-Performance Computing (HPC) environment while supporting semiconductor manufacturing operations and AI/ML workloads., * Install, configure, maintain, and support Red Hat Enterprise Linux systems across on-site infrastructure.
- Ensure systems are securely configured, patched, and monitored in accordance with organizational and government standards.
- Use automation tools and scripts to standardize system configuration and reduce manual effort.
- Monitor system health, performance, and availability; troubleshoot and resolve issues proactively.
- Utilize security tools to identify vulnerabilities, evaluate risk, and apply remediation.
- Respond to system and security incidents, coordinating with appropriate stakeholders..
- Support the introduction and operationalization of new technologies, including GPU-enabled servers.
- Support the introduction and operation of AI/ML and GPU enabled technologies within the HPC environments.
- Collaborate with Information Assurance (IA) and engineering teams to meet evolving compute and security needs.
- Network Administration.
Requirements
The ideal candidate brings strong Red Hat Linux experience, practical use of various security and automation tools, and the ability to operate in a controlled, compliance-driven environment. The candidate will also have had exposure to GPU-enabled infrastructure., * Experience using Red Hat-associated tools (eg: Ansible, Satellite, Insights, or similar automation and lifecycle management tools).
- Experience working in data center, compute cluster, or high-performance computing environments.
- Familiarity with security monitoring, vulnerability scanning, and SIEM platforms.
- Experience automating administrative tasks using scripting languages such as Bash, Python, or PowerShell.
- Exposure to GPU-enabled systems, including basic installation, driver management, and operational support.
- Understanding of Linux-based compute workloads that benefit from accelerators (GPU, high-memory, parallel workloads).
- Experience operating in a regulated environment with formal security and compliance requirements.
- Ability to obtain and maintain a U.S. Government Security Clearance.
Preferred technical and professional experience
Must be able to obtain a CompTIA Security+ within 6 months of hire and an ISC2 CISSP within 1 year.
